## Service Accounts — StormFan Alert Fan-Out

The fan-out worker authenticates to the internal dispatch tier using the svc-stormfan account. Rotate quarterly; scopes are limited to publish-only on alert topics. If deliveries stall during your shift, verify the worker is using the current credential, reproduced below for reference.

API key for kaweg-hahif: kto4_rAjZ

Welcome to supporting the Pictomill thumbnail generation queue. When customers report missing thumbnails, first check the queue depth in the Pictomill dashboard; anything over ten thousand pending jobs indicates a stalled worker. Restart workers one at a time, never all at once, or the queue will duplicate jobs. Restarting requires signing in to the queue operator account, whose recovery passphrase appears below.

strongbox words: norwyn-wenael-aldvan-aldiel-wendor-holael

## Deployment

Paperpress renders invoice PDFs for the Lumenquist billing stack. Deploys go through the standard Harbrook pipeline; a canary instance takes 5% of traffic for thirty minutes before full rollout. Rollback is a single pipeline re-run against the previous tag. Font assets ship inside the image, so no volume mounts are needed. On startup, the renderer reads the configuration shown below.

config for bahop-fajep:
DRUATH_PIN=4501
DRUATH_TENANT=briwyn
DRUATH_METRICS_HOST=metrics.druath.brasksoft.test
DRUATH_SEAL=seal_7d2e069d
DRUATH_STANDBY_TEAM=olieth

### Retrying failed exports

When a Ledgerloom export job fails, check the dead-letter view in the Ferrow console first; most failures are transient upstream timeouts and can be safely requeued. Use the retry CLI from the tools repo, which reads its configuration from the .env in your workspace. Set EXPORT_REGION and BATCH_SIZE as documented above. The export service credential belongs on the next line.

env line for fafof-fahag: LEDGER_TOKEN5=f8790